Ready to move from Divemaster to educator?

The SSI Assistant Instructor Course at Dive Aran gives you the skills and confidence to begin teaching under supervision while building your experience in real world conditions.


You’ll learn how to assist with courses, conduct training sessions, and help new divers discover the underwater world all while surrounded by the stunning scenery of the Aran Islands.


This course can be taken on its own or as part of a longer professional pathway. Many candidates choose to combine the course with summer work experience at Dive Aran, leading naturally into the Instructor Course in September.


Note: The Assistant Instructor Course is also the first phase of the full SSI Instructor Training Course if you decide to go straight into the Instructor Course.

Flexible Pathways

  • Option 1 - Assistant Instructor Course only

Take the course as a stand-alone program and gain valuable teaching experience. A perfect choice if you want to progress at your own pace or return later for the Instructor Course.


  • Option 2 - Assistant + Work Experience + Instructor Course

Join our May Assistant Instructor Course, stay with us through the summer as part of Dive Aran’s team (free of charge), and then continue to the Instructor Course in September. This combination provides the ideal opportunity to build confidence, refine your teaching skills, and log real experience in a working dive centre.


Please note: Taking the Assistant Instructor Course is recommended but not mandatory. Qualified Divemasters may apply directly to the Instructor Course if preferred, they will complete the Assistant Instructor component within that program.

During your course, you will:

  • Assist classes, workshops, and student training
  • Practice teaching and leadership skills
  • Dive daily, including presentations and scenario teaching
  • Work closely with instructor trainers to refine your style


1. Assistant Instructor Phase (Days 1-5):

  • Orientation + Academic Session: SSI and Instructor Roles
  • In-Water Teaching & Workshop (OW Diver / Skills Update)
  • Teaching Workshops: Perfect Buoyancy, Specialty Programs
  • Pool/Confined Water Presentations & Evaluations
  • Academic and Teaching Exam, Instructor Presentation Skills


As an SSI Assistant Instructor, you can:

  • Teach and certify Try Scuba and Scuba Skills Update under indirect supervision
  • Conduct academic and confined-water training under instructor supervision
  • Assist instructors with open-water training and student evaluation
